Abstract
Experiments on RF discharge characteristics and lasing performance were carried out using a table top configuration, cryogenically cooled laser using an uprated 27-MHz generator supplying over 5-kW RF input power. The RF electrode shape and position relative to the discharge tube has been found to influence laser performance. A maximum output power of 1.08 kW has been attained from a plane-concave resonator at 105 Torr, 7.6 g/s mass flow, gas inlet temperature of 145 K, and RF input power of 34 W/cm3, corresponding to a 28% conversion efficiency.
